Preparing Your Home for a Hurricane

What Should I Do to Prepare My House for a Hurricane?

When a hurricane is on the horizon, taking proactive steps to safeguard your home is essential. Here’s what you can do to minimize potential damage:

Secure Outdoor Items: Strong winds can turn even lightweight items into dangerous projectiles. Secure or bring indoors any loose objects like patio furniture, grills, and potted plants.

Trim Trees and Shrubs: Overhanging branches and weak trees can easily break during a hurricane, causing damage to your property. Trim and prune your trees and shrubs to reduce the risk.

Reinforce Doors and Windows: Install storm shutters or board up windows and glass doors to prevent debris from shattering them during the storm. Reinforce garage doors to prevent them from buckling under pressure.

Inspect the Roof: A well-maintained roof can better withstand high winds. Replace any damaged shingles and secure loose ones to prevent leaks and further damage.

Clear Gutters and Drains: Make sure gutters and drains are clear of debris to allow water to flow freely. Clogged gutters can lead to water pooling and potential flooding.

Check Sump Pump: If your area is prone to flooding, ensure your sump pump is working efficiently to prevent water from entering your basement.

Create an Emergency Kit: Prepare a kit with essentials like water, non-perishable food, medications, flashlights, batteries, and important documents. Make sure it’s easily accessible.

Turn Off Utilities: Before the storm hits, turn off gas, water, and electricity to reduce the risk of accidents or damage during power surges.

How Do You Prepare for a Hurricane in California?

While California isn’t as hurricane-prone as some other states, it’s important to be prepared. Here’s how:

Stay Informed: Monitor weather forecasts and updates from local authorities. Sign up for emergency alerts to stay informed about any potential hurricanes.

Create an Evacuation Plan: If you live in an area prone to flooding or high winds, have a plan for where you’ll go in case of evacuation. Know multiple routes to get there.

Secure Important Documents: Gather essential documents such as insurance policies, identification, and medical records. Store them in a waterproof container or digitally online.

Review Your Insurance Coverage: Make sure your homeowner’s insurance covers hurricane damage. Consider adding flood insurance if you’re in a flood-prone area.

Stock Up on Supplies: Keep an emergency kit ready with water, non-perishable food, medications, and basic tools. Remember to include items for your pets as well.

Stay Connected: Have a battery-powered or hand-crank radio to stay updated if power and internet services are disrupted.

Support Your Community: Check in on neighbors, especially those who may need assistance during a hurricane.
